4. Wildlife Adaptation

The cruel circumstances inherent to the interval of chilly in southwestern Montana exert a big selective strain on native wildlife, necessitating a variety of variations for survival. These variations, encompassing physiological, behavioral, and morphological modifications, are essential for species to endure sub-zero temperatures, diminished meals availability, and elevated vitality calls for. The interaction between wildlife and this difficult season is a defining function of the area’s ecology, shaping species distributions and inhabitants dynamics.

Examples of wildlife adaptation are quite a few and diversified. Mammals comparable to elk and deer exhibit seasonal migrations to decrease elevations to keep away from deep snow and entry extra available forage. Smaller mammals, like rodents, usually make the most of subnivean areas beneath the snowpack to insulate themselves from excessive chilly and evade predators. Physiological variations embody elevated fats reserves, thicker fur or plumage, and specialised circulatory programs to preserve warmth. Behavioral variations comparable to huddling collectively for heat, lowering exercise ranges to preserve vitality, and altering foraging methods are additionally frequent. Birds, confronted with restricted meals assets, both migrate to hotter climates or adapt their diets to out there seeds and berries.

Understanding wildlife adaptation is important for efficient conservation and administration methods. Local weather change, with its potential to change snowpack, temperature regimes, and vegetation patterns, poses a big menace to wildlife populations which might be already tailored to particular seasonal circumstances. Defending crucial winter habitats, mitigating human-wildlife conflicts, and implementing adaptive administration practices are essential for guaranteeing the long-term survival of those species. The sensible significance of this understanding extends to informing land-use planning, recreation administration, and coverage selections geared toward balancing human actions with the preservation of ecological integrity.

7. Avalanche Danger

The convergence of heavy snowfall, steep terrain, and fluctuating temperatures through the interval of chilly in southwestern Montana creates important avalanche threat. This threat impacts leisure actions, infrastructure, and residential areas, necessitating vigilant monitoring, mitigation, and public consciousness efforts.

  • Terrain Elements

    The mountainous topography attribute of southwestern Montana contributes considerably to avalanche threat. Slopes exceeding 30 levels in steepness are significantly vulnerable to avalanche formation, particularly when mixed with particular snowpack circumstances. Convex slopes, gullies, and areas beneath ridgelines are additionally high-risk zones on account of their propensity to build up snow and focus stress inside the snowpack. The orientation of slopes relative to prevailing winds and photo voltaic radiation influences snow accumulation and stability, additional complicating avalanche prediction.

  • Snowpack Construction

    Avalanche formation is intrinsically linked to the construction and layering of the snowpack. Weak layers, comparable to buried floor hoar, faceted crystals, or crusts, act as failure planes inside the snowpack, growing the probability of avalanches. These weak layers can develop on account of various climate circumstances, together with temperature fluctuations, wind occasions, and precipitation patterns. The presence of a robust layer overlying a weak layer creates a slab avalanche situation, the place a cohesive slab of snow releases and slides over the underlying weak layer.

  • Climate Influences

    Climate patterns exert a direct affect on avalanche threat by affecting snowpack stability. Heavy snowfall occasions, significantly when accompanied by excessive winds, can quickly overload slopes and enhance the probability of avalanches. Rain on snow occasions can destabilize the snowpack by including weight and altering the snow crystal construction. Speedy temperature will increase can weaken the snowpack by melting floor layers and making a lubricating impact. Extended durations of chilly temperatures can even contribute to avalanche threat by selling the formation of persistent weak layers.

  • Human Triggering

    Human actions, comparable to snowboarding, snowboarding, snowmobiling, and climbing, can set off avalanches, significantly in unstable snowpack circumstances. The added weight of an individual or machine can exceed the power of a weak layer, initiating a fracture and resulting in an avalanche. Backcountry vacationers should possess the data, expertise, and tools essential to assess avalanche threat and make knowledgeable selections about their security. Avalanche training programs, climate forecasts, and snowpack stories present beneficial info for mitigating the danger of human-triggered avalanches.

The advanced interaction between terrain, snowpack, climate, and human elements underscores the persistent avalanche threat inherent to the seasonal setting. Efficient avalanche administration requires a multi-faceted strategy that integrates scientific monitoring, threat evaluation, public training, and proactive mitigation measures to guard lives and infrastructure inside the Massive Sky area.
